“”艰难“”AC
dsrics
今朝有酒今朝醉
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Restricted RPS
原题地址 这道题就是一道模拟题,跟着模拟就行了。 自己条件写的迷糊了,WA了好多次才改正。 #include <bits/stdc++.h> using namespace std; #define ll long long int main() { int t;cin >>t; while(t--){ int n;cin>>n...原创 2019-11-02 09:46:58 · 422 阅读 · 0 评论 -
Good ol' Numbers Coloring
原题地址 这道题是道思维题,自己没想到是gcd,导致这场比赛后面的题做的时候心态炸了。 题意:给你两个数,询问是否有无限个黑色的区域(判断是否是黑色区域题目中写的很清楚) 思路:因为1和任何数都会使黑色区域有限(其实都是白的,没有黑的。。),且发现样例中的6 , 9 黑色区域是无限的,然后自己写了几个数去推发现只要gcd(a,b)==1,那么黑色区域就是有限的。反之就是无限的。 (自己憨批了,看见...原创 2019-11-02 09:44:45 · 456 阅读 · 0 评论 -
2019CCPC 1007
原题地址 题意:就是让你输出CCPC,第I次的CCPC中的C都是i-1次的ccpc,第i次的P为i-1次的ccpc到过来图形 题解:因为是2^n的方阵,且列子才10个,数据不大,可以直接暴力。也可以一行一行输出。 附上代码: #include <iostream> #include <algorithm> #include <cmath> #include &l...原创 2019-08-25 21:04:14 · 210 阅读 · 2 评论 -
2019CCPC 1006
原题地址 题意:把一个堆牌,按照他抽出来的顺序,倒着放在第一位置。(有相同的牌,按照最后抽出来的为准)然后剩下的牌按照初始顺序输出。 题解:定义三个空数组,第一个数组存放一开始的位置,然后第二个数组存放抽出来的顺序,最后一个初始化全为零。然后先倒着判断第三个数组中第二个数组存的数字为不为0, 为0,输出此第二个数组存放的数字,然后把第三个数组的这个数字赋值为1 不为1,略过 判断完第二个之后,在...原创 2019-08-25 20:58:25 · 201 阅读 · 0 评论 -
2019CCPC 1001
原题地址 题意:就是让你输出当(a^c)&( b ^ c)这个式子最小时候C最小值 看起来是个数学题,但其实是个水题,有多种方法做 第一种,打表找规律,然后按规律做就行 第二种,化简式子。因为^这个东西是异或的意思所以(a ^ c)可以化为(非ac)+(a非c);同理把( b ^ c),化为这种形式,之后换件就变成了(a*b) ^ c。 根据 ^ 的性质可以得到: 如果(a * ...原创 2019-08-25 20:48:29 · 213 阅读 · 0 评论 -
AtCoder - 2641 Trained?
原题地址 附上代码: #include <iostream> #include <algorithm> #include <cmath> #include <vector> #include <string> #include <iomanip> //#include <string.h> #include <...原创 2019-08-15 19:30:39 · 153 阅读 · 0 评论 -
AtCoder - 2586 Insertion
原题地址 这道题卡了我一定时间,大致题意就是让我们补“(“ ,”)” 大概思路就是直接找“(”的个数,和“)”的个数就行 附上代码: #include <iostream> #include <algorithm> #include <cmath> #include <vector> #include <string> #include ...原创 2019-08-15 19:28:28 · 188 阅读 · 0 评论 -
2057金牌、银牌、铜牌
原题地址 主要是记录一下关于vector的一些用法。 #include <iostream> #include <algorithm> #include <cmath> #include <vector> #include <string> #include <iomanip> //#include <string.h&...原创 2019-08-08 22:08:00 · 231 阅读 · 0 评论 -
2054数据结构实验之链表九:双向链表
原题地址 记录一下自己通过查百度而写出来的代码 #include <iostream> #include <algorithm> #include <cmath> #include <vector> #include <string> #include <iomanip> #include <string.h> #...原创 2019-08-08 22:05:07 · 121 阅读 · 0 评论 -
C语言实验——余弦
原题地址 记录一下,自己是怎么把一个简单问题复杂化。。。 题意很清楚,只是我这里对pow的函数使用只局限于平方,且-1的处理还用了判断,整体代码长度过于繁琐。 看了网上的答案,发现人家的代码十分简便,故此学习学习。 #include<iostream> #include<vector> #include<bits/stdc++.h> using namespac...原创 2019-07-18 16:31:25 · 230 阅读 · 0 评论 -
A. Nauuo and Votes
原题地址 这道题十分水 , 只要考虑明白不确定的数量 与上升和下降之间的关系就行。 附上代码: #include<iostream> #include<bits/stdc++.h> #include<string> #include<cmath> #include<iomanip> #include<algorithm> us...原创 2019-06-08 13:17:58 · 150 阅读 · 0 评论 -
2019山东ACM省赛F题
原题地址 这道题很简单 , 题意就是说有n个筐子 , 里面有不定量的石头。然后作者想让你把所有筐子的石头给平均一下。 然后条件是: 1.Remove a stone from one of the non-empty buckets. 2.Move a stone from one of the buckets (must be non-empty) to any other bucket (ca...原创 2019-06-01 10:27:21 · 170 阅读 · 0 评论 -
HDU--1397
原题地址 一道关于素数的水题,可以直接用板子。 记录一下自己的犯傻经历。需要自己反思的事情就是 , 自己对板子理解不够深彻 , 欧拉筛法用了两个数组来判断是否是素数 , 然而自己直盯着那个存了素数的数组, 没有关注那个按顺序排的vis数组(bool的那个),其实只要判断这个bool的数组是否在相应位置是true就可以了 , 自己非要用双重for超时好多发。。。 这个是超时的代码: #include...原创 2019-06-01 10:17:50 · 189 阅读 · 0 评论 -
2019山东ACM省赛M题
地址 这道题题意很简单, 就是只狼死一次 , 钱掉一半,并向上取整 ,就是数据太大 , 普通做法会TLE,要考虑当只狼身上金钱数只剩1或0的情况时, 只狼的金钱数是不变的。 附上蒟蒻AC代码: #include <iostream> #include <algorithm> #include <cmath> //#include <bits/stdc++....原创 2019-05-26 21:28:29 · 259 阅读 · 0 评论 -
2019山东ACM省赛A题
地址 这道题很水 ,应该十分钟内就解决 。但是我的思路比较僵硬, 想用if来判断星期几 , 然后就发现WA了。然后换成用char数组来存字母 , 在对天数做处理就过了。 第一次代码: #include <iostream> #include <algorithm> #include <cmath> //#include <bits/stdc++.h>...原创 2019-05-26 20:32:38 · 257 阅读 · 0 评论 -
ZOJ - 3782
原题地址 这道题很水,注意后面的运算符是“* , / , %”时先运算他就行 说说我的写的时候的经历,一开始想用string直接存,后发现这样太傻了还麻烦,于是就有改用char了 附上蒟蒻代码 #include<iostream> #include<stdio.h> #include<cstring> #include<algorithm> #inc...原创 2019-05-05 21:05:01 · 189 阅读 · 0 评论 -
16thZhejiang Provincial Collegiate Programming Contest Sponsored by TuSimp I Fibonacci in the Pocket
原题地址 题意就是用斐波那切数组,然后题上定义了F1=1,F2=1.然后,在下标为a 到 b的范围内的F(i)相加的和是偶数就输出0 否则就输出1。 因为 对斐波那切数组取3的模发现是有规律的,就是从1开始为1 , 1 , 0 , 1 , 1 , 0的循环 所以问题就变成了,把下标为a 和 b 对3取模,在带进斐波那切数组,在进行相加,在取2模,判断。 然后发现,a ,b的范围超过long lo...原创 2019-04-28 20:18:05 · 303 阅读 · 0 评论 -
Codeforces Round #554 (Div. 2) A. Neko Finds Grapes
原题地址 这道题还是很水的,但是自己有点小傻。。。一开始纯暴力一发直接TLE。。。。然后开始找规律,发现只要使第一行的奇数与第二行的偶数判断大小就行,同理第一行的偶数与第二行的奇数判断大小。 其他也就没啥要注意的了。。 附上蒟蒻代码 #include<bits/stdc++.h> using namespace std; int a[1000000]; int b[1000000]; ...原创 2019-04-27 20:36:57 · 193 阅读 · 0 评论
分享